git-gui: grey out comment lines in commit message

Comment lines are stripped by wash_commit_message, but there is no indication in the UI that they are special and will be removed. Grey these lines out to indicate that they will be removed. Signed-off-by: Wolfgang Faust <contrib-git@wolfgangfaust.com> Signed-off-by: Johannes Sixt <j6t@kdbg.org>
